This listing is for a Roadmaster Mounting Bracket / Baseplate that will mount to a towable vehicles undercarriage and allow a towbar to be connected to it to tow behind another vehicle. (Tow Bar and other accessories sold separate. This is only the bracket)
Part # 3154-3 Fits:
The visible portion of the brackets, the "front arms," can be easily removed when not towing — remove two hitch pins to convert from towed car to road car in seconds!
- They're virtually invisible — improved aesthetics
- For motorhome-mounted tow bars
- Computer-cut, all-steel components for exceptional strength
- Easy to install — ROADMASTER brackets use existing attachment points on the vehicle's undercarriage — no welding!
- Most install through the grille — no scraping brackets in dips or against curbs.
Note: the MX bracket does not accommodate the Guardian rock shield, Stowaway, some models of the Tow Defender, the StowMaster and StowMaster All Terrain tow bars.
Why are ROADMASTER mounting brackets rated #1?
- Every bracket design is subjected to computer-simulated "Finite Elemental Analysis". ROADMASTER was the first towing products manufacturer to invest in the software and technology that Boeing, Lockheed Martin, GM and NASA use to ensure the integrity of their products. This allows ROADMASTER to offer the safest products possible for your family.
- Every mounting bracket is custom-made to fit a specific vehicle or range of vehicles, and to attach at logical points along the frame or undercarriage, for maximum strength and a quick, easy installation (in lieu of specific mechanical experience with similar products, professional installation is recommended).
- Every new bracket (not just a few) in the ROADMASTER XL, MX, AND 'EZ Twistlock' series (the brackets are described below) comes with detachable extensions which are easily removed when the vehicle isn't being towed — no unsightly steel hanging off the front of your car!
- Every bracket is powder-coated. In this process, charged particles of pigment are baked into the surface of the bracket. The particles fuse to the metal and form a lustrous, uniform and extremely durable finish.
- ROADMASTER is quick to market brackets for new vehicles, and has the widest selection — currently, more than 1,000 different mounting brackets (far more than any other company) — which fit more than 2,000 different makes and models.

Fri, 20 Apr 2012Lamborghini's SUV show car, the Urus 4x4 concept, has leaked early ahead of its planned debut at the 2012 Beijing auto show this weekend. These leaked photos of the Lamborghini Urus reveal a swooping, coupe-alike crossover - marrying the style of a Lamborghini Reventon or supercar with the stance of an SUV. Lamborghini Urus: the leaked images We'd been expecting a sleek crossover, especially since yesterday's media invitation revealed an outline sketch of the Urus.
